What is the difference between Clinical Systems Trainer vs Clinical Analyst?
| Aspect | Clinical Systems Trainer | Clinical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Healthcare certifications, IT training | Healthcare certifications, data analysis skills |
| Work Environment | Training sessions, workshops, healthcare facilities | Data analysis, system optimization, healthcare settings |
| Employer & Industry | Hospitals, clinics, healthcare IT companies | Hospitals, healthcare organizations, IT firms |
| Search & Comparison Intent | Understanding training roles, job differences | Analyzing healthcare data, system improvements |
The Clinical Systems Trainer primarily focuses on educating healthcare staff on new or existing clinical software, ensuring effective system use. In contrast, the Clinical Analyst analyzes clinical data to improve workflows and system performance. Both roles require healthcare and IT knowledge but serve different functions within healthcare organizations.

Job description
The Clinical Systems Trainer is responsible for training, implementation support, adoption, and optimization of Yardi and other clinical technology solutions across a multi-site senior living and healthcare environment. This role partners with clinical, operational, and technology leaders to support successful system implementations, workflow alignment, user adoption, regulatory compliance, and ongoing performance improvement. The Clinical Systems Trainer serves as a subject matter expert, educator, and change champion to help communities maximize the value of clinical systems and support high-quality resident care delivery.
This position reports to the Director, Clinical Systems.

What You'll Do:
- Develop and deliver engaging in-person and virtual training sessions on Yardi for clinical staff, including onboarding, refresher education, role-based training, new feature rollouts, and go-live readiness.
- Tailor training plans and materials to address the unique needs of communities, departments, clinical disciplines, and user roles.
- Lead or support portions of Yardi implementations, new community conversions, module deployments, and workflow changes.
- Coordinate training logistics, readiness activities, go-live support, and post-go-live stabilization in partnership with clinical, operational, and IT stakeholders.
- Create, maintain, and continuously improve training resources, quick reference guides, job aids, FAQs, and knowledge base content to support user proficiency in Yardi.
- Ensure training resources remain current with system enhancements, configuration changes, regulatory expectations, and approved clinical workflows.
- Serve as a Yardi subject matter expert and resource for clinical and operational teams, helping users understand proper system use and workflow expectations.
- Gather feedback from community staff and leaders regarding system usability, training effectiveness, workflow barriers, and adoption challenges.
- Monitor system utilization, adoption trends, support themes, and training feedback to identify opportunities for additional education, workflow improvement, or system optimization.
- Partner with clinical leadership to help ensure Yardi workflows support regulatory requirements, documentation standards, survey readiness, and organizational policies.
- Support organizational change management efforts by promoting adoption of new workflows, technology enhancements, system best practices, and standardized processes.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support integrations, process improvements, vendor communications, and clinical technology initiatives involving Yardi or related systems.
- Participate in development of community readiness plans, implementation lessons learned, and ongoing clinical systems education programs.
What We're Looking For:
- Bachelor's degree in healthcare, nursing, health information technology, education, clinical informatics, or a related field, or equivalent experience required.
- Minimum of 4 to 6 years of related experience in clinical systems training, healthcare technology, EHR implementation, nursing operations, senior living, long-term care, or a related healthcare technology role required.
- Experience developing and delivering training to diverse audiences in virtual and in-person formats required.
- Strong communication, facilitation, and presentation skills with the ability to engage clinical, operational, and technical audiences required.
- Problem-solving skills with the ability to assess system-related questions, identify root causes, and determine whether the issue is related to training, workflow, configuration, or technical support required.
- Organizational skills with strong attention to detail and the ability to manage multiple priorities, communities, and initiatives simultaneously required.
- Familiarity with healthcare regulatory standards, documentation expectations, privacy requirements, and compliance considerations required.
- Hands-on experience with Yardi, including clinical workflows or modules, preferred.
- Experience supporting Yardi implementations, conversions, module rollouts, or go-live events preferred.
- Experience in senior living, assisted living, memory care, skilled nursing, home health, or long-term care preferred.
- Clinical license or background, such as LPN, RN, or comparable clinical operations experience, preferred.
- Experience with adult learning principles, instructional design, eLearning development, or learning management systems preferred.
- Experience using Microsoft 365 tools, Teams, SharePoint, reporting tools, or knowledge management platforms preferred.
- Experience supporting workflow standardization, change management, process improvement, or adoption initiatives preferred.
